The theme of this unit is human and nature, focusing on the theme of wildlife protection. Nature is a complex ecosystem, in which there are delicate balance between animals and plants. Because of the role of the food chain, the extinction of one species will produce influence, causing a series of chain reaction. Large scale extinction of species will have a serious and even irreversible impact on the ecosystem, resulting in immeasurable losses. Therefore, it is of great significance to protect wild species. To protect wild species is to protect human beings themselves. 2.表示現(xiàn)階段正在進(jìn)行的被動(dòng)動(dòng)作(該動(dòng)作在說(shuō)話(huà)的瞬間未必正在進(jìn)行)。Many interesting experiments are being carried out these days.(說(shuō)話(huà)時(shí),并不一定正在進(jìn)行)3.表示一種經(jīng)常性的被動(dòng)行為,常和always,constantly 等表示頻度的副詞連用,這種用法常常帶有贊揚(yáng)或厭惡的感情色彩。He is always being praised by the leader.4.表示按計(jì)劃或安排主語(yǔ)將要承受謂語(yǔ)動(dòng)詞所表示的動(dòng)作(僅限于少數(shù)及物動(dòng)詞)。A party is being held tonight.Step 4 Special cases1.像take care of, look after, talk about, think of等動(dòng)詞與介詞構(gòu)成的短語(yǔ)用于現(xiàn)在進(jìn)行時(shí)的被動(dòng)語(yǔ)態(tài)時(shí), 其中的介詞不可省略。The ways to stop illegally hunting are being talked about. 2.可與部分情態(tài)動(dòng)詞連用,表示對(duì)正在發(fā)生的事情的推測(cè)。She may be being punished by her mother.3.有時(shí)可表示按計(jì)劃或安排將要進(jìn)行的一個(gè)被動(dòng)動(dòng)作。A celebration is being held this weekend for his success.4.某些表示“狀態(tài)、心理活動(dòng)、存在”等的動(dòng)詞,如have,want,need,love,一般不用現(xiàn)在進(jìn)行時(shí)的被動(dòng)語(yǔ)態(tài),而常用一般現(xiàn)在時(shí)的被動(dòng)語(yǔ)態(tài)。With the population increasing,more land is needed.5.“be+under/in+n.”可表示現(xiàn)在進(jìn)行時(shí)的被動(dòng)意義。My computer is under repair.=My computer is being repaired.

In the 16th century, the nearby country of Wales (2) __________(join) to the Kingdom of England. In the 19 th century, the Kingdom of Ireland was added to create the United Kingdom of Great Britain and Ireland. Finally, the southern part of Ireland (3) ______ (break) away from the UK, which resulted in the full name we have today. However, most people just use the (4)_________(shorten) name: the UK.
